Embodiment 1

[0058] Embodiment 1 A kind of method of utilizing urban and rural domestic garbage and sludge to prepare industrial foaming filler

[0059] A method for preparing industrial foam filler by utilizing urban and rural household garbage and sludge, said method comprising the following preparation steps:

[0060] Step (1): Dispose of domestic waste:

[0061] ①Material sorting: Disassemble the material and remove non-domestic waste;

[0062] ②Material cracking: tearing, cutting, and crushing the sorted materials to crack all kinds of materials in domestic waste;

[0063] ③Material analysis: add the decomposed urban and rural domestic waste to the solid waste pollutant treatment system, the system temperature is 800°C, decompose the compounds in the domestic waste, analyze, crack, condense and carbonize the organic matter, and obtain material 1;

Abstract

The invention discloses a method for preparing industrial foaming filler with urban and rural household refuse and sludge. The method mainly includes the steps that household refuse and sludge with non-organic matter as the main component are subjected to resolving treatment, and residues serve as aggregate for preparing the industrial foaming filler; sludge with organic matter as the main component is subjected to hydrolysis treatment, and hydrolyzate serves as a foamer base material; the foamer base material, a foam booster and an additive are used for preparing a composite foamer; the aggregate obtained by treating the household refuse or the non-organic sludge, the composite foamer and cement are mixed and homogenized, water is added, stirring is performed, foaming machine filling is performed, and then the industrial foaming filler is obtained. The filler is small in thermal conductivity and water absorptivity, free of mildewing, resistant to chemical corrosion, stable in performance, fireproof, nonflammable, safe and reliable, and can be applied to freeze protection, heat preservation, heat insulation, shock absorption, noise reduction, housing construction, decoration engineering and roads, sponge cities and wetland construction.

technical field [0001] The invention relates to the harmless treatment and resource utilization technology of solid pollutants, in particular to a method for preparing industrial foaming fillers by using urban and rural household garbage and sludge. Background technique [0002] Urban and rural domestic garbage and sludge have caused great harm: organic matter rots, compounds decompose, emit ammonia, hydrogen sulfide, odor and other toxic and harmful gases, pollute the atmosphere; viruses, bacteria, insect eggs, etc. reproduce, breed, and spread; pollution The pollutants seep into the ground along with the sewage, flow into the river, pollute the land and the groundwater system; decompose or ionize the metal and its compounds, pollute the water body and the land.
